Abstract
The electric polarization in a zero magnetic field and in a magnetic field of 12 kOe is measured in a GdxMn1 – xSe solid solution in the percolation concentration region in the temperature range 80–380 K. For composition x = 0.15, the polarization hysteresis and the dependence of the remanent polarization on magnetic field and temperature are determined. The hysteresis is explained in the model of migration polarization and the magnetoelectric effect is explained in the Maxwell–Wagner model.
